Analysis
The most recent figure for tx - person-years lived above age x in Yemen is 6.58 million, measured in 2021.
The figure is down 1.1% on the previous year and down 3.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, tx - person-years lived above age x in Yemen peaked at 6.88 million in 2013 and was at its lowest, 6.31 million, in 2000.
Yemen ranks 141st of 184 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
Tx - person-years lived above age x in Yemen,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 6.31 million | — |
| 2001 | 6.36 million | +0.9% |
| 2002 | 6.42 million | +0.8% |
| 2003 | 6.47 million | +0.8% |
| 2004 | 6.52 million | +0.8% |
| 2005 | 6.58 million | +0.8% |
| 2006 | 6.63 million | +0.8% |
| 2007 | 6.67 million | +0.7% |
| 2008 | 6.72 million | +0.7% |
| 2009 | 6.76 million | +0.6% |
| 2010 | 6.80 million | +0.5% |
| 2011 | 6.81 million | +0.3% |
| 2012 | 6.83 million | +0.2% |
| 2013 | 6.88 million | +0.7% |
| 2014 | 6.87 million | -0.1% |
| 2015 | 6.83 million | -0.7% |
| 2016 | 6.77 million | -0.8% |
| 2017 | 6.77 million | -0.0% |
| 2018 | 6.64 million | -1.9% |
| 2019 | 6.69 million | +0.8% |
| 2020 | 6.65 million | -0.6% |
| 2021 | 6.58 million | -1.1% |
